About the Program

The Renaissance Art course at Trinity College Dublin is a Non-degree program for individuals interested in Art History, taught in English, and lasting 1 year. It helps students deepen their understanding of the cultural and historical contexts of the Renaissance era.

The curriculum covers key themes and artworks from the Renaissance, with a focus on critical analysis and observational skills. Students engage with influential artists and the socio-political factors that influenced their creations through lectures and discussions.

Graduates can pursue roles such as art historians, museum curators, or educators. They can also work in cultural management and heritage conservation, with skills transferable to numerous fields, including art-related industries where historical context is invaluable.
